Caught In Bed With Daughter‑in‑Law, Father Bludgeons Son To Death In Kadoma
Caught In Bed With Daughter‑in‑Law, Father Bludgeons Son To Death In Kadoma

A 78‑year‑old man from Kadoma, Benjamin Harry, has been accused of killing his son after being caught in bed with his daughter‑in‑law.

On 6 January, Benjamin’s son, Kudakwashe Harry (30), allegedly walked in and found his father having sex with his wife, Evelyn Mashava (22).

A heated confrontation followed. During the row, Benjamin is said to have armed himself with an iron bar and struck Kudakwashe, killing him on the spot.

Following the incident, Benjamin was arrested along with Evelyn, Mike Hwata (36), William Grasham (34), Perfect Vembo (18), Tongai Mavhurume (18), and a 16‑year‑old boy.

Tongai and the minor are Evelyn’s brothers.

All of them now face murder charges and have been remanded in custody under case number Kadoma Rural 27/1/26.

However, different versions of events have since emerged. According to the first account, Kudakwashe discovered his father with Evelyn, confronted him, and was fatally struck with the iron bar.

After the killing, Benjamin allegedly panicked and asked Evelyn’s brothers to help move the body.

It is claimed they hung Kudakwashe’s body from a tree to make it look like suicide, with Benjamin offering one of his cows as payment.

Neighbours were also allegedly approached to assist in staging the scene.

Another version suggests that Perfect Vembo and William, both said to be former lovers of Evelyn, were involved in a confrontation with Kudakwashe that contributed to his death.

A post‑mortem revealed that Kudakwashe suffered severe head injuries consistent with being struck by an iron bar.

Evelyn’s statements further suggest her brothers were involved in the fight, allegedly trying to protect her from abuse by her husband.
